Hier mal mein Lösungsansatz (ich nehm mal an, weiss ist am Zug):
Die Idee ist es, rechtzeitig das feld f5 mit dem Läufer oder dem König zu blokieren, wonach Bh6 durchrennt.
1. Le2+!! Ke4 (Der schwarze Monarch darf die schwarzen Felder nicht betreten, da er dort sond seinem Läufer im Weg steht. Und auf Kxe2 bzw. Kg2 kommt der weisse König schnell nach f5: 2. Kc3 Lh2 3.Kd4 Le5+ 4.Ke4 Lb2 5.Kf5 +-)
2.Kc2 (nun kann schwaz nicht mehr mit Tempo auf die lange Diagonale) f5 (2....Ld4 3.Ld3+ Kf4 4.Lf5 Kxf5 5.h7+-)
3.Lf3+ Kxf3 (3. ... Kf4 4.Kd3 +-)
4.Kd3 Lh2
5.Kd4 Lg1+
6.Kd5 und obwohl schwarz zu f5 gekommen ist, kann er den Bauern nicht mehr aufhalten.
Ich hoffe ich hab nicht schon wieder haufen Notationsfehler kombiniert mit Schachblindheit hingeschrieben

Aber eine hübsche Studie, vor allem da weiss trotz des 2. schwarzen Zuges gewinnt